Johnson & Johnson is recruiting for a Finance Director of Global Technical Accounting Advisory Services & Policy (GTAAS) which is part of the Corporate Controllership function. This position will report to the Vice President of GTAAS and is based in the World Headquarters office in New Brunswick NJ.

The individual in this position will lead direct and advise on U.S. GAAP and J&Js worldwide policies and procedures related to financial accounting and reporting with a heavy focus on the accounting related to revenue recognition inventory leases fixed assets impairments and various other topics. Additionally this role will advise on proper disclosure requirements for our SEC filings and other public filings. The person in this role will also assist in other projects led by GTAAS including the implementation of new accounting standards training initiatives and updates to accounting policies.

Responsibilities

  • Lead and advise on accounting and reporting for complex business transactions collaborating with business leaders and finance teams across all sectors to ensure accounting consistency and support strategic business decisions.
  • Serve as a key contact in interfacing with external and internal auditors to ensure that all business transactions are aligned to both U.S. GAAP and J&Js policies.
  • Advise on the development of U.S. GAAP financial statements and footnote information in support of our SEC filings and other filings such as carve-out financial statements.
  • Monitor and evaluate emerging accounting and regulatory developments (e.g. FASB and SEC) and determine potential impacts to J&J working closely with other relevant stakeholders within J&J. Also lead efforts in the implementation of new accounting and reporting standards for the company.
  • Develop and deliver training and education throughout the finance organization regarding accounting and reporting updates.
  • Lead other special projects that may be outside of core responsibilities such as accounting for acquisitions assisting with divestitures (including carve-out financial statements) and evaluating the design of internal controls
  • Mentor and develop other team members of GTAAS fostering a culture of learning inclusion and excellence.

Minimum requirements for this role/keys to success in this role:

  • Bachelors degree in Accounting
  • CPA required
  • 10 years of accounting external financial reporting financial controls or auditing experience
  • Strong knowledge of U.S. GAAP and SEC rules and regulations is required combined with the ability to research and propose company positions on complex accounting issues. Strong knowledge of the following technical accounting areas related to the pharmaceutical and medical device industries is preferred: Revenue Recognition; Inventory; Leases; Impairments of Long-Lived Assets; Licensing Arrangements; Business Restructuring
  • Ability to react to changes quickly and work effectively in high-pressure situations managing multiple projects at a time
  • Ability to exercise a high level of independent judgment influence and execution working in complex environments and driving change
  • Excellent written and verbal skills and ability to build collaborative relationships. This role will require the preparation of technical accounting memorandums and the ability to clearly articulate the accounting to other finance leaders and external auditors
